Business Application Delivery Manager manages a team of business application delivery programmers. Improves operational processes and supports critical business strategies by managing the development, implementation, and maintenance of applications systems. Being a Business Application Delivery Manager leads multiple projects and oversees programmers to ensure that established policies and procedures are followed correctly. Trains programmers on standard methodologies, tools, and best practices to ensure high-quality deliverables. Additionally, Business Application Delivery Manager establishes deadlines, develops goals, and tracks performance metrics for the department. Typ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a director. The Business Application Delivery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Business Application Delivery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
